It's another loaded episode of The Pro Wrestling Time Tunnel!On Episode 72, Steve Gennerelli joins me as we step back into 1976 for a deep dive into the WWWF. We break down the dramatic Bruno Sammartino broken neck angle, the heated return match against Stan Hansen, and the massive impact it had on the territory. Plus, we examine the historic Inoki vs. Ali mixed wrestler-versus-boxer match and share more key insights into the WWWF during that pivotal year. I’m also excited to launch a brand-new recurring segment: The Life and Career of Dory Funk Sr.! We kick things off by looking back at the significant events of 1965 and how they set the stage for the pivotal year of 1966. Then we head 60 years back in time to the Wild West Texas rings of Western States Sports for some raw, hard-hitting territory history. And finally, the one and only George Schire returns to the show to answer a fan question with his personal thoughts on the Top 5 AWA World Heavyweight Champions of all time!This is a stacked episode packed with territory-era gold you don’t want to miss.Episode 72 is live now here on Substack and on Castos, Apple Podcasts, Spotify, YouTube, and all your favorite platforms.
